Bullet Proof Glass Market Dynamics

Rise in Global Military Expenditure

All the major world powers are currently modernizing and expanding their armed forces and hence, defense spending has soared.

With a few exceptions, all the major world powers have a well-developed military-technical base, allowing them to field new and innovative weaponry more quickly at reduced costs. Most acquisition funds go towards high-tech weaponry such as fighter jets, warships and tanks. However, significant expenditure is also made towards defensive acquisitions, such as troop protection, including bulletproof glass. More attention is now paid to troop survivability and limiting battlefield casualties; hence spending on ballistic protection such as armor and bulletproof glass for troop vehicles is set to increase.

High Costs Associated with Bulletproof Glass

Bulletproof undergoes a complex manufacturing process. The glass must be thick enough to withstand multiple shots from handguns and rifles. However, the index of refraction must be kept intact between the multiple levels since the glass must be transparent. High-skilled labor is required for the manufacturing of bulletproof glass.

Innovative and proprietary technologies are used in the manufacturing process, increasing costs. Bulletproof glass is also made to order; hence each glass panel manufactured is uniquely customized to clients' requirements. The only mass production occurs for institutional buyers, such as the police and the military. The aforementioned facts increase the production price of bulletproof glass and increase the end-product price. 

Bullet Proof Glass Market Segment Analysis

The global bulletproof glass market is segmented based on security, material, end-user and region.

The material has unique properties that make it ideal for various purposes, ranging from basic household items to fiber optic cables that power the world. Bulletproof glass made up of acrylic sheets provides a safe and cost-effective solution to the challenge of creating safer environments. The glasses are more than 30% less expensive than other bulletproof glass made of bullet-resistant laminated glass and polycarbonate.

Furthermore, bullet-resistant plexiglass is the most often purchased bulletproof material since it can be drilled, routed, cut and mounted without cracking or shattering any structure. In addition, bullet-resistant plexiglass can be polished and is optically clear. Moreover, bullet-resistant systems based on monolithic acrylic can be built to UL-rated level 1 or level 2 bullet resistance. The aforementioned factors play a key role in boosting the demand for acrylic in the global bulletproof glass market.
